Regulations made under the National Forests Act (No. R. 466 of 2009).

Abstract
These Regulations implement provisions of the National Forests Act, 1998 and makes provision for a wide variety of matters regarding the management, use and conservation of forests and the preservation of trees.
The Regulations provide, among other things, for: licensing of establishment of a plantation in a state forest; licensing of felling and removal of trees in a state forest; licensing of grazing of herds, use of land for cultivation purposes, hunting and fishing, mining and other activities in state forests; licensing of activities in respect of indigenous trees and protected trees in protected forest areas, setting aside of protected areas on private land; and assistance to community forestry.
